Key Responsibilities

  • Lead the delivery, technical review, and quality assurance of complex and high‑profile fire engineering projects across a variety of sectors.
  • Develop and oversee fire strategies and innovative engineering solutions that meet regulatory and client requirements.
  • Provide technical leadership and guidance to engineers at all stages of their careers.
  • Contribute to business development activities, helping to secure and grow new opportunities.
  • Support recruitment, workforce planning, and succession planning initiatives.
  • Mentor and coach team members, supporting their professional and technical development.
  • Contribute to company strategy, operational improvements, and business planning.
  • Build and maintain strong relationships with clients, stakeholders, regulators, and project teams.
  • Stay informed of developments in UK fire legislation, building safety regulations, and industry best practice.
  • Promote a culture of technical excellence, collaboration, and continuous improvement.

About You

Essential Requirements:

  • Significant experience within a fire engineering consultancy environment, typically around 10 years or more, although the quality and breadth of experience are more important than the exact number of years.
  • Proven track record of delivering fire strategies and complex fire engineering solutions across a range of projects.
  • Strong understanding of UK fire engineering legislation, regulations, and the evolving building safety landscape.
  • Experience leading or supporting technical teams and providing technical oversight.
  • Excellent written, verbal, and presentation skills.
  • Ability to build trusted relationships with clients, colleagues, and stakeholders.

Desirable Requirements:

  • Chartered Engineer (CEng) status or actively working towards chartership.
  • Demonstrated success in developing and maintaining long‑term client relationships.
  • Commercial awareness and project management experience.
  • Experience contributing to business development, proposal writing, and tender submissions.
  • Experience leading teams, mentoring engineers, and supporting organisational growth.
